Bajaj Intends to Sell 1 Mn Units Annually with Bajaj Pulsar 135
Bajaj Pulsar is one of the most successful models from Bajaj Auto. It currently sells 50,000 Pulsars annually and “with the introduction of this variant we hope to sell 35,000 more per month, which will help in reaching our goal of 1 million a year in the coming financial year," said Milind Bade, Bajaj Auto General Manager (Marketing)at the launch of Pulsar 135 LS. He also stated that the company intends to increase the "the size of the pie." By the end of the next financial year, it expects market share of sports bike to increase from 16 percent to 20-25 percent.
Pulsar 135LS is the only light sports bike in the country. It is also the only bike in the world that has four-valve DTSi engine. Recently, the bike has also been adjudged as the ET-Zigwheels Bike of the Year 2009. The model clearly reciprocates the fun that a bike stands for, clubbed with perfect combination of ease of use and practicality. Bajaj Pulsar 135LS topped the chart amongst the 12 bikes that were driven, ridden and judged by the jury of ET-Zigwheels.
With the biking culture gaining popularity in India, Bajaj hopes to encash upon the growing trend.
